(GPRE) reported Q1 2026 earnings per share (EPS) of $0.42, far surpassing the consensus estimate of $0.0571 and delivering a staggering 635.55% positive surprise. Revenue figures were not disclosed for the quarter. Following the announcement, the stock rose 2.65%, reflecting investor optimism around the company’s cost management and margin improvement despite a lack of topline detail.

The standout EPS beat in Q1 2026 underscores Green Plains’ ability to drive profitability through operational discipline and improved plant utilization. The company likely benefited from favorable ethanol production margins and effective hedging strategies during the quarter. Green Plains has been focused on optimizing its corn oil extraction yield and protein production at its biorefineries, which may have contributed to lower per‑unit costs. With no revenue data provided, the earnings surprise appears to stem primarily from cost‑side efficiencies rather than a surge in sales volumes. The company’s continued investments in high‑value co‑products—such as Ultra-High Protein and Clean Sugar Technology—may have started to yield incremental contributions. However, without segment‑level breakdowns, the precise drivers remain unclear. The margin environment for ethanol producers has been volatile, but Green Plains’ performance suggests that its operational streamlining and strategic feedstock sourcing helped buffer against input‑cost swings.

Management did not issue formal guidance alongside the Q1 2026 report. Looking ahead, the company likely expects ethanol demand to remain supported by the Renewable Fuel Standard and growing interest in low‑carbon fuels, though trade policy and corn price fluctuations could introduce headwinds. Green Plains’ strategic shift toward higher‑margin bioproducts may continue to bolster earnings, but the pace of adoption and capacity expansions will be critical. The company may also face rising competition in the sustainable aviation fuel (SAF) space, which could influence its capital allocation decisions. Additionally, if corn harvests prove plentiful, feedstock costs might ease further, offering potential margin relief. On the other hand, any prolonged weakness in gasoline blending or reduced export demand could pressure ethanol prices. Investors should watch for updates on Green Plains’ low‑carbon initiatives and any progress on its flagship protein and oil projects.

The stock’s 2.65% gain on the earnings release indicates a measured positive reaction, likely because the revenue omission tempered some enthusiasm. The massive EPS beat may attract fresh analyst attention, with several firms possibly revising their earnings estimates upward in the coming weeks. However, the lack of revenue disclosure leaves a key variable unknown—if top‑line growth remains stagnant, the sustainability of such high margins could be questioned. Key catalysts to monitor include the next quarter’s revenue figures, ethanol price trends, and any regulatory updates from the EPA regarding blending mandates. Additionally, the company’s debt profile and cash flow generation should be assessed to gauge the durability of its earnings improvement. As Green Plains continues to diversify beyond traditional ethanol, execution on its bioproducts pipeline will be pivotal. Overall, Q1 2026 marks an encouraging start to the fiscal year, but a fuller picture will require more transparency in the quarters ahead.
